Missions 316 (Formerly Titus International Mission) (EIN: 62-1191811)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Missions 316 (Formerly Titus International Mission), a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 2 out of 18 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$46,080. The highest compensated employee at Missions 316 (Formerly Titus International Mission) is Michael Allen with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$62,177. Missions 316 (Formerly Titus International Mission) changed its name from Titus International Mission in 2022.

Mission Statement

MISSIONS 3:16 IS A MISSION AGENCY DEDICATED TO THE FULFILLMENT OF THE GREAT COMMISSION BY SENDING MISSIONARIES TO AS MANY PEOPLE GROUPS AS POSSIBLE IN THE FIELDS OF THE WORLD AND BY TRAINING AND PARTNERING WITH NATIONAL PASTORS TO ESTABLISH LOCAL CHURCHES AND/OR OTHER LEGAL MEANS, TO REACH THEIR WORLD FOR CHRIST.
